Approximately 1% of the general male population has azoospermia, and nonobstructive azoospermia accounts for the majority of cases. The causes vary widely, including chromosomal and genetic abnormalities, varicocele, drug-induced causes, and gonadotropin deficiency; however, the cause is often unknown. In azoospermia caused by hypogonadotropic hypogonadism, gonadotropin replacement therapy can be expected to produce sperm in the ejaculate. In some cases, upfront varicocelectomy for nonobstructive azoospermia with varicocele may result in the appearance of ejaculated spermatozoa; however, the appropriate indication should be selected. Each guideline recommends microdissection testicular sperm extraction for nonobstructive azoospermia in terms of successful sperm retrieval and avoidance of complications. Sperm retrieval rates generally ranged from 20% to 70% but vary depending on the causative disease. Various attempts have been made to predict sperm retrieval and improve sperm retrieval rates; however, the evidence is insufficient. Further evidence accumulation is needed for salvage treatment in cases of failed sperm retrieval. In Japan, there is inadequate provision on the right to know the origin of children born from artificial insemination of donated sperm and the rights of sperm donors, as well as information on unrelated family members, and the development of these systems is challenging. In the future, it is hoped that the pathogenesis of nonobstructive azoospermia with an unknown cause will be elucidated and that technology for omics technologies, human spermatogenesis using pluripotent cells, and organ culture methods will be developed.

OBJECTIVE: In December 2021, enfortumab vedotin (EV), an antibody-drug conjugate directed against nectin-4, was approved in Japan as a new treatment after platinum-containing chemotherapy and PD-1/PD-L1 inhibitors. This study evaluated, using real-world data, the efficacy and safety of EV therapy in patients with metastatic urothelial carcinoma (mUC). MATERIALS AND METHODS: Fifty-five patients with mUC who discontinued pembrolizumab therapy due to disease progression between June 2018 and April 2023 at Yokohama City University Hospital were evaluated retrospectively. Of the 55 patients, 25 received EV therapy (EV group) and 30 did not (non-EV group). All patients who underwent EV therapy were diagnosed with disease progression after the approval of EV in Japan. RESULTS: The median (range) follow-up period after pembrolizumab discontinuation was 6.3 (0.7-31.1) months. There were eight (32.0%) deaths due to cancer in the EV group and 27 (90.0%) in the non-EV group. The overall survival (OS) after pembrolizumab discontinuation was not reached in the EV group versus 2.6 months in the non-EV group (p < 0.001). A multivariate analysis revealed that EV therapy (EV vs. non-EV group; hazard ratio 0.26; 95% confidence interval 0.16-0.41; p < 0.001) was an independent prognostic factor for OS. CONCLUSION: EV prolonged OS in mUC following pembrolizumab therapy in real-world data.

BACKGROUND: Our web-based training program called "Educating Medical Professionals about Reproductive Issues in Cancer Healthcare" aims to help healthcare professionals communicate promptly with patients and survivors who are adolescents and young adults, with information pertinent to reproductive health issues such as the risk of infertility and fertility preservation. METHODS: The study participants were professional healthcare providers, including physicians, nurses, pharmacists, social workers, midwives, psychologists, laboratory technicians, genetic counselors, and dieticians. Pre- and post- and 3-month follow-up tests consisting of 41 questions were administered to measure changes in knowledge and confidence. The participants also received a follow-up survey that covered confidence, communication techniques, and practice habits. A total of 820 healthcare providers participated in this program. RESULTS: The mean total score from the pre-test to the post-test grew significantly (p < 0.01), and participants' self-confidence increased. In addition, there was a change in the behavior of healthcare providers, who began asking about patients' marital status and parity. CONCLUSION: Our web-based fertility preservation training program improved knowledge and self-confidence regarding fertility preservation issues among healthcare providers caring for adolescents and young adult cancer patients and survivors.

Partial nephrectomy (PN) is the standard treatment for T1 renal cell carcinoma. PN is affected more by surgical variations and requires greater surgical experience than radical nephrectomy. Patient-specific simulations and navigation systems may help to reduce the surgical experience required for PN. Recent advances in three-dimensional (3D) virtual reality (VR) imaging and 3D printing technology have allowed accurate patient-specific simulations and navigation systems. We reviewed previous studies about patient-specific simulations and navigation systems for PN. Recently, image reconstruction technology has developed, and commercial software that converts two-dimensional images into 3D images has become available. Many urologists are now able to view 3DVR images when preparing for PN. Surgical simulations based on 3DVR images can change surgical plans and improve surgical outcomes, and are useful during patient consultations. Patient-specific simulators that are capable of simulating surgical procedures, the gold-standard form of patient-specific simulations, have also been reported. Besides VR, 3D printing is also useful for understanding patient-specific information. Some studies have reported simulation and navigation systems for PN based on solid 3D models. Patient-specific simulations are a form of preoperative preparation, whereas patient-specific navigation is used intraoperatively. Navigation-assisted PN procedures using 3DVR images have become increasingly common, especially in robotic surgery. Some studies found that these systems produced improvements in surgical outcomes. Once its accuracy has been confirmed, it is hoped that this technology will spread further and become more generalized.

OBJECTIVES: To investigate the predictive factors for pentafecta achievement of robot-assisted partial nephrectomy (RAPN) for intermediate highly complex renal tumors (RENAL score ≥ 7). METHODS: We retrospectively analyzed the data of 247 patients with renal tumors with a RENAL score ≥ 7 who underwent RAPN. Baseline characteristics and perioperative outcomes were compared between the pentafecta achieved group and the unachieved group. A multivariable logistic regression model was used to identify the predictive factors for pentafecta achievement for cT1 renal tumors with a RENAL score ≥ 7. RESULTS: Of the 247 patients, 75 (30.3%) patients were in the achieved group and 172 (69.7%) patients were in the unachieved group. The median warm ischemia time and total operation time were 18 min versus 23 min (p < 0.001) and 179 min versus 201 min (p < 0.001) in the achieved and unachieved groups, respectively. In the unachieved group, six patients (3.4%) had major perioperative complications (Clavien-Dindo classification system ≥3). The median preservation rates of estimated GFR at the 1-year postoperative period were 96.5% versus 83.0% (p < 0.001) in the achieved and unachieved groups. Multivariable logistic regression models revealed that age and tumor size were independent predictive factors for pentafecta achievement for cT1 renal tumors with a RENAL score ≥ 7. There were no significant differences in cancer-free survival between the two groups (p = 0.456). CONCLUSION: Age and tumor size were independent predictive factors for pentafecta achievement, although there was no difference in oncological outcomes between the pentafecta achieved group and the unachieved group in RAPN for cT1 renal tumors with a RENAL score ≥ 7.

Klinefelter syndrome and monozygotic twins are both rare. The reports of monozygotic twins with Klinefelter syndrome to have undergone fertility treatment are uncommon. This case report describes a case of 30-year-old monozygotic adult twin brothers diagnosed with nonmosaic Klinefelter syndrome following the complaint of infertility. The result of semen analysis showed cryptozoospermia (very low sperm count) and azoospermia (zero sperm count) with physical findings and lifestyles being very similar. They both underwent microtesticular sperm extraction. One had successful sperm retrieval and achieved pregnancy through intracytoplasmic sperm injection, whereas the other did not. Testicular pathological findings showed Sertoli cell-only syndrome. To the best of our knowledge, this is the first report on monozygotic adult twins both of whom underwent microtesticular sperm extraction and resulted in different outcomes.

OBJECTIVE: To evaluate the efficacy of keishibukuryogan, a traditional Kampo formula known to be an anti-Oketsu (impaired microcirculation and non-physiological blood congestion) drug, in combination with an anti-oxidant for the treatment of varicoceles. METHODS: We retrospectively analyzed 119 patients with palpable and subclinical varicoceles who were treated with 7.5 g/day of keishibukuryogan and 600 mg/day of tocopherol nicotinate. Their motile sperm concentrations at the start of medication and after 3 months were compared. As a subgroup analysis, a comparison test was carried out between patients with a high-grade varicocele and those with a low-grade varicocele. RESULTS: The mean age of the study patients was 35.6 years. Among them, 17, 41, 44 and 17 had subclinical, grade 1, grade 2 and grade 3 varicoceles, respectively. Overall, the differences in motile sperm concentration (millions/mL) before and after treatment were not significant (median 0.58, 95% confidence interval -0.12 to 1.56; P = 0.115). The results of the subgroup analysis showed that the motile sperm concentration in patients with a low-grade varicocele significantly increased (median 1.21, 95% confidence interval 0.45-2.47; P = 0.024); however, no significant improvements were seen in patients with a high-grade varicocele. CONCLUSIONS: The results of the present study showed that the combination of keishibukuryogan and an anti-oxidant had a limited effect on varicoceles, but they suggest that it is effective for the treatment of low-grade varicoceles.

Background: Newly emerging serious post-treatment complications among young male cancer survivors involve fertility and sexual function, preventing them from pursuing a normal family life. Methods: We studied and summarized published studies that assess the relationship between cancer treatments and reduced spermatogenesis or sexual dysfunction. Main findings: Infertility often occurs because of anticancer therapies that impair spermatogenesis. While some patients postremission functionally recover fertility, others experience a decreased sperm count and azoospermia. Fertility-preserving modalities are currently being promoted worldwide to preserve spermatogenesis following cancer therapy. Patients who can ejaculate and have sperm in their semen should cryopreserve semen. However, for patients who have never ejaculated before puberty or in whom spermatogenesis has not been established, testis biopsy is performed to collect and preserve sperm or germ cells. Fertility preservation is gaining popularity and requires continuous information dissemination to oncologists and cancer treatment professionals. Furthermore, male sexual dysfunction predominantly involves erectile dysfunction and ejaculation disorder. Conclusion: Although preventive and therapeutic methods for these disorders have been established within urology, patients and medical professionals in other fields remain uninformed of these advances. Therefore, dissemination of information regarding fertility preservation techniques should be accelerated.

In vitro mouse spermatogenesis using a classical organ culture method became possible by supplementing basal culture medium with only the product of bovine serum albumin purified by chromatography (AlbuMAX), which indicated that AlbuMAX contained every chemical factor necessary for mouse spermatogenesis. However, since the identity of these factors was unclear, improvements in culture media and our understanding of the nutritional and signal substances required for spermatogenesis were hindered. In the present study, chemically defined media (CDM) without AlbuMAX was used to evaluate each supplementary factor and their combinations for the induction of spermatogenesis. Similar to in vivo conditions, retinoic acid, triiodothyronine (T3 ), and testosterone (T) were needed. Based on differences in spermatogenic competence between AlbuMAX, fetal bovine serum, and adult bovine serum, we identified α-tocopherol, which strongly promoted spermatogenesis when combined with ascorbic acid and glutathione. Differences were also observed in the abilities of lipids extracted from AlbuMAX using two different methods to induce spermatogenesis. This led to the identification of lysophospholipids, particularly lysophosphatidylcholine, lysophosphatidic acid, and lysophosphatidylserine, as important molecules for spermatogenesis. New CDM formulated based on these results induced and promoted spermatogenesis as efficiently as AlbuMAX-containing medium. In vitro spermatogenesis with CDM may provide a unique experimental system for research on spermatogenesis that cannot be performed in in vivo experiments.

PURPOSE: To assess the effect of our new classification on surgical outcomes after flexible ureteroscopy (fURS) for kidney stones. METHODS: We retrospectively examined 128 patients after single renal fURS procedures performed using ureteral access sheaths (UASs) with the fragmentation technique. Based on the gap (calculated by subtracting the ureteroscope diameter from the UAS diameter), enrolled patients were divided into three groups: small (< 0.6 mm), medium (0.6 to < 1.2 mm), and large space groups (≥ 1.2 mm). Stone-free (SF) status was defined as either complete absence of stones (SF) or the presence of stones < 4 mm in diameter on non-contrast computed tomography (NCCT). RESULTS: The SF rate was significantly lower in the small space group (50% in small, 97.9% in medium, 89.2% in large; p = 0.001). Perioperative complications over Clavien-Dindo Grade I were observed in 16.7%, 4.2%, and 8.1% of patients, respectively (p = 0.452). The ratio of stone volume and operative time (efficiency of stone removal) was significantly higher in the large space group compared to the small and medium space groups (0.009 ± 0.003 ml/min, 0.013 ± 0.005 ml/min, 0.027 ± 0.012 ml/min, respectively; p < 0.001). CONCLUSION: Our findings that gaps > 0.6 mm (1.8 Fr), including the combination of a 9.5-Fr UAS and a small caliber ureteroscope, improve SF rates, and larger gaps facilitate stone removal efficiency providing the basis for future development of clinical protocols aimed at improving outcomes.

Cancer therapy has priority over fertility preservation. The time available for fertility preservation in patients with cancer is often very limited and depends on the condition of the underlying disease. This case report presents the results of two rounds of controlled ovarian stimulations (COSs) performed after an induced abortion. The patient had mixed phenotype acute leukemia diagnosed during early pregnancy and underwent a surgical abortion, followed by ovarian stimulation using urinary follicle-stimulating hormone (uFSH) and gonadotropin-releasing hormone (GnRH) agonists. Oocyte retrieval was subsequently performed for oocyte cryopreservation. Despite good hormonal and ultrasonic follicular growth, no oocytes were obtained. During a second COS performed at a low human chorionic gonadotropin (hCG) level (less than 100 IU/L), several mature oocytes were obtained, suggesting that higher hCG levels during COS induce the absence of mature oocytes during normal follicular growth. It is recommended to start COS post-abortion after confirming a low hCG level while considering the timing of cancer treatment.

PURPOSE: To identify risk factors by developing and internally validating a nomogram for preventing perioperative complications in overnight ureteral catheterization cases after fURS for kidney stones. METHODS: We retrospectively examined 309 patients with overnight ureteral catheterization after single fURS procedures for renal stones. fURS procedures were performed based on the fragmentation technique. The ureteral catheter was removed on postoperative day 1. Within this group, patients who experienced perioperative complications (complication group) were compared with those who did not experience complications (non-complication group). The complication group included 77 patients whose Clavien-Dindo classification score was I, II, III, or IV and/or those whose body temperature during hospitalization was over 37.5 °C. RESULTS: The overall stone volume, stone-free rate, incidence of perioperative complications, and procedure duration were 1.39 mL, 94.8%, 24.9%, and 62 min, respectively. Severe complications of a Clavien-Dindo level III or IV were observed in only four cases (1.3%). Multivariate assessment revealed five independent predictors of perioperative complications after fURS with overnight catheterization: age (p = 0.11), sex (p = 0.067), stone volume (p = 0.33), Hounsfield units (p = 0.16), and narrow ureter (p = 0.018). We developed a nomogram to predict perioperative complications after fURS using these parameters. CONCLUSIONS: We developed a predictive model for perioperative complications of patients with overnight catheterization after fURS for renal stones. This model could select patients who were at a low risk of complications.

PURPOSE: Mouse in vitro spermatogenesis is possible with classical organ culture methods, by placing the testis tissue at the interphase between culture medium and air. In this condition, however, a tissue piece tends to round up to be compact, whose central region suffers from shortage of nutrients and oxygen. In this study, the authors improved the culture condition by spreading each tissue thin and flat, by which they were able to get better access to the oxygen and nutrients. METHODS: Immature mouse testis tissues placed on agarose gel block were forced to spread flat by covering with a polydimethylsiloxane (PDMS) ceiling chip (PC chip). They were then cultured for weeks and evaluated by the transgene expression of Acr-Gfp, which reflects the progression of spermatogenesis. RESULTS: Testis tissues covered with PC chip initiated and maintained spermatogenesis in its wider region than those without PC chip covering. Flow cytometric analysis demonstrated that the PC method yielded more numerous meiotic germ cells than those without PC. Immunohistochemical examination confirmed the authentic histological figure of spermatogenesis from spermatogonia up to round or elongating spermatids. CONCLUSIONS: The PC chip method is simple and effective to improve the efficiency of in vitro spermatogenesis in the organ culture system.

In our previous study, we produced a microfluidic device (MFD) which successfully maintained spermatogenesis for over 6 months in mouse testis tissues loaded in the device. In the present study, we developed a new MFD, a monolayer device (ML-D) with a barrier structure consisting of pillars and slits, which is simpler in design and easier to make. This ML-D was also effective for inducing mouse spermatogenesis and maintained it for a longer period than the conventional culture method. In addition, we devised a way of introducing sample tissue into the device during its production, just before bonding the upper layer of polydimethylsiloxane (PDMS) and bottom glass slide. The tissue can obtain nutrients horizontally from the medium running beside it and oxygen vertically from above through PDMS. In addition, the glass slide set at the bottom improved the visibility of the sample tissue with an inverted microscope. When we took photos of cultured tissue of the Acr-Gfp transgenic mouse testis in ML-D sequentially every day, morphological changes of the acrosome during spermiogenesis were successfully recorded. The ML-D is simple in design and useful for culturing testis tissue for inducing and maintaining spermatogenesis with clearer visibility. Due to the new method of sample loading, tissues other than testis should also be applicable.

Organ culture experiments can be hampered by central degeneration or necrosis due to the inadequate permeation of oxygen and nutrients, which deteriorates the function and growth of cultured tissues. In the current study, we aimed to overcome this limitation of organ culture through spreading the tissue two dimensionally on an agarose gel stand and molding into a disc shape by placing a ceiling of polydimethylsiloxane (PDMS) chip, which is highly oxygen permeable. By this, every part of the tissue can receive a sufficient supply of oxygen through PDMS as well as nutrients through the agarose gel below. This method not only prevented central necrosis of tissues, but also supported the tissue growth over time. In addition, such growth, as volume enlargement, could be easily measured. Under these conditions, we examined the effect of several factors on the growth of neonatal mouse testis, and found that follicle stimulating hormone (FSH) and insulin significantly promoted the growth. These results are in good agreement with previous in vivo reports. Notably, the growth achieved over 7 days in our in vitro system is almost comparable to, about 80% of, that observed in vivo. Thus, we successfully monitored the promotion of tissue growth beyond the limits of the conventional organ culture method. This extremely simple method could offer a unique platform to evaluate the growth as well as functional properties of organs, not only the testis but also others as well.

PURPOSE: To evaluate the influence of overnight ureteral catheterization and determine if routine long-term post-stenting can be avoided in flexible ureterorenoscopy (fURS) procedure for kidney stone. METHODS: Three hundred ninety-three patients who underwent single fURS for kidney stone between January 2013 and June 2016 at a single institute were retrospectively analyzed. The stone-free (SF) and perioperative complication rates in patients with routine long-term post-stenting after fURS (long-term stent group) were compared with those of patients with overnight ureteral catheterization (short-term stent group). Propensity score-matching analysis was used to adjust the difference in baseline preoperative parameters between the two groups. All preoperative parameters were chosen to develop the propensity score, and 74 patients in the short-term stent group were retrospectively matched with the patients in the long-term stent group at a 1:1 ratio. RESULTS: Patient characteristics included age, sex, side of involvement, height, body weight, body mass index, number of stone(s), stone volume, Hounsfield units of stone, preoperative white blood cell count, preoperative C-reactive protein, preoperative creatinine, pretreatment, pre-stenting, stenosis of the ureter, and procedure duration. The SF rates were 91.9 and 93.2% in the short-term and long-term stent groups, respectively. Perioperative complications were 14.9 and 12.2%. No difference was noted between the two groups in terms of SF and perioperative complication rates. CONCLUSIONS: Short-term post-stenting using overnight ureteral catheterization in uncomplicated cases after fURS for kidney stone was as effective as conventional long-term post-stenting in reducing postoperative complications. These preliminary data suggest the possibility that routine long-term post-stenting was unnecessary.

BACKGROUND: Spermatogenesis is one of the most complicated cellular differentiation processes in a body. Researchers struggled to find and develop a micro-environmental condition that can support the process in vitro. Such endeavors can be traced back to a century ago and are yet continuing. METHODS: Reports on in vitro spermatogenesis and related works were selected and classified into four categories based on the method used; organ culture, tubule culture, cell culture, and 3-dimensional cell culture methods. Each report was critically reviewed from the present point of view by authors who have been working on in vitro spermatogenesis with organ culture method over a decade. RESULTS: The organ culture method has the longest history and is the most successful method, which produced fertile mouse sperm from spermatogonial stem cells. Formulation of the medium was a key factor, most importantly serum-derived substances. However, factors in the serum that induce and support spermatogenesis in the cultured tissue remain to be identified. In addition, the success of mouse spermatogenesis is yet to be applied to other animals. On looking into the history of cell culture method, it became clear that Sertoli cells as feeder cells play an important role. Even with Sertoli cells, however, spermatogenic development has been limited to small parts of spermatogenesis, a segmented period of meiotic prophase for instance. Recent developments of organoid or 3-dimensional culture techniques are promising but they still need further refinements. CONCLUSION: The study of in vitro spermatogenesis progressed significantly over the last century. We need more work, however, to establish a culture system that can induce and maintain complete spermatogenesis of many if not all mammalian species.

A 43-year-old man underwent extracorporeal shock wave lithotripsy (ESWL) for a left ureteral stone and implantation of a loop stent for the treatment of stone pain in February 2011. However, he was lost to follow-up before the complete removal of the stones and stent. He presented to our hospital with left back pain in March 2015. An abdominal radiograph and a noncontrast computed tomography showed extensive stone formation throughout the stent. A single cystolithotripsy and a double endoscopic combined intrarenal surgery (ECIRS)were performed. All the stones and the encrusted ureteral stent were successfully removed.

Male infertility is most commonly caused by spermatogenic defects or insufficiencies, the majority of which are as yet cureless. Recently, we succeeded in cultivating mouse testicular tissues for producing fertile sperm from spermatogonial stem cells. Here, we show that one of the most severe types of spermatogenic defect mutant can be treated by the culture method without any genetic manipulations. The Sl/Sl(d) mouse is used as a model of such male infertility. The testis of the Sl/Sl(d) mouse has only primitive spermatogonia as germ cells, lacking any sign of spermatogenesis owing to mutations of the c-kit ligand (KITL) gene that cause the loss of membrane-bound-type KITL from the surface of Sertoli cells. To compensate for the deficit, we cultured testis tissues of Sl/Sl(d) mice with a medium containing recombinant KITL and found that it induced the differentiation of spermatogonia up to the end of meiosis. We further discovered that colony stimulating factor-1 (CSF-1) enhances the effect of KITL and promotes spermatogenesis up to the production of sperm. Microinsemination of haploid cells resulted in delivery of healthy offspring. This study demonstrated that spermatogenic impairments can be treated in vitro with the supplementation of certain factors or substances that are insufficient in the original testes.

PURPOSE: To identify the risk factors for perioperative complications to prevent perioperative complications after complete ipsilateral upper urinary stone removal using flexible ureterorenoscopy. MATERIALS AND METHODS: We retrospectively examined 111 patients who underwent flexible ureterorenoscopy for ipsilateral renal stones with a diameter ≥ 5 mm at the same time as ureterorenoscopy for ureteric stones. The flexible ureterorenoscopy procedures were performed following the fragmentation technique. Patients who experienced (complication group) and did not experience (non-complication group) perioperative complications were compared. The complication group included 33 patients with Clavien-Dindo classification scores of I, II, III, or IV and/or those with a body temperature of > 37.5 â„ƒ during hospitalization. RESULTS: The overall stone volume, stone-free rate and procedure duration were 1.71 mL, 96.4% and 77 min, respectively. The rate of perioperative complications was 29.7% (grade 1, 2 and 3 was 23.4%, 5.4% and 0.9%, respectively). Severe complications (Clavien-Dindo grade 4) were not observed. Multivariable analysis revealed that ureteral stone volume and female patients were independent predictors of perioperative complications after flexible ureterorenoscopy (p = 0.015 and 0.017, respectively). CONCLUSIONS: This study showed that ureteral stone volume and female gender have the possibility to increase perioperative complications. These preliminary data help to select for patients who are at low risk of complications. Therefore, in these selected patients, complete ipsilateral upper urinary tract stone removal using flexible ureterorenoscopy may reduce the recurrence of urolithiasis without increasing perioperative complications.
